Germany, Luftwaffe. A Bomber Clasp, Gold Grade, By Richard Simm & Söhne Auction Archive in formations(Frontflugspange fr Kampf und Sturzkampfflieger in Gold). Constructed of gilded zink, the obverse consisting of a central circular laurel leaf wreath, joined together at the bottom by a swastika, surrounding a central winged bomb, flanked on each side by nine oak leaves, the reverse with a central visible rivet securing the obverse bomb in place, with a barrel hinge and tapering horizontal pinback meeting a flat wire catch, maker marked with the logo
